Convert Petabit to Tebibyte
Unit definitions
Petabit
${10}^{15}$ bits equal one petabit.
Tebibyte
${2}^{40}$ bytes equal one tebibyte.
How to convert Petabit to Tebibyte
$$\text{Data and Storage}_{\text{TiB}} = \text{Data and Storage}_{\text{Pb}} \cdot 113.6868377216160297393798828125$$
